Tammy N
Nice and clean hotel except for the train noise. The subway train is half block away. At night time you can hear the loud noise of the train every 5 minutes. There is no self parking, and the valet parking is $73/day.

Yuva Sun
This property is a right mixture for both Business & Leisure Travellers. Room is well maintained with Kitchen. A four members family can cook and enjoy the food in the room. You will find Trader Joe market in less than half a mile for any grocery needs. Gym is well equipped modernly and Guest Laundry is also good. Complimentary Breakfast is worth to mention with variety of hot & cold options. Crew there is so lovely and helpful. And don't forget to enjoy complimentary Wine & Beer Happy Hours during weekdays. Front desk is also very caring especially Bob who attends every need with empathy. And he remembers his guests and recalls the room numbers as well. Convenient store is available. Parking is valet and entrance is just across the busy street. Nearby activities: City Hall and convention center
